10 Tips for Shell & Tube Type Heat Exchanger Factories to Guarantee Peak Performance

Tip Number Tip Description Expected Outcome
1 Conduct regular maintenance checks to identify issues early. Increased equipment lifespan and reliability.
2 Ensure proper insulation to reduce heat loss. Improved energy efficiency and reduced operational costs.
3 Utilize advanced materials to enhance durability. Longer service life and lower maintenance frequency.
4 Implement real-time monitoring systems for performance tracking. Immediate response to performance deviations.
5 Optimize design layout to enhance flow and heat transfer. Maximized heat exchanger efficiency.
6 Train staff on proper operating procedures and safety measures. Reduced accidents and improved operational knowledge.
7 Regularly review and update operational protocols. Enhanced adaptability to industry changes.
8 Select appropriate coolant and heating fluids based on application. Improved thermal performance.
9 Employ a feedback loop for continuous improvement. Sustained peak performance over time.
10 Collaborate with heat exchanger experts for custom solutions. Tailored performance enhancements for specific applications.
